Union Agriculture Minister, Shivraj Singh Chauhan said, that the government will purchase all farm produce at minimum support price while addressing the parliament in the Question Hour. Chauhan gave assurance while he was answering the issue of MSP to farmers.
“I want to assure the house through you that all produce of farmers will be purchased at minimum support price. This is the Modi government and the guarantee to fulfill Modi’s guarantee,” Chouhan told the house.

This assurance comes when farmers have already planned to embark on a foot march to Delhi with their demands. Countering opposition remarks, he claimed that when the opposition was in power, they were not in favor of acceptance of the M S Swaminathan Commission recommendations. He said that he has proof as a record that Congress was not keen, especially on giving 50 percent more than the cost of produce.

The minister stated that since 2019 Prime Minister Narendra Modi has decided to calculate the minimum support price by giving 50 percent profit on cost of production to farmers. Already, paddy wheat, jowar, and soybean were being purchased at 50 percent above the cost of production from three years ago. He also cited intervention in changing export duties and prices whenever rates of commodities fall.
